Transaction eef8a5a1084e6c9c55093088711871d17168a9aece51bc150098507592734536
1 Input
1 Output
-
eef8a5a1084e6c9c55093088711871d17168a9aece51bc150098507592734536:0
- value
- 23212297
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d421d8e4aed07a93b9f463b4467f427a8b4ff20
- address
- ltc1qd4ppmrj2a5r6jwulgca5gel5y75tfleqhrre48